System IP Address: 82.29.122.201 Last Update: January 25, 2011 at 08:43:03 Amplifier: 'Bluesatron' integrated with 834P-based phono stage and RCA 801/Tribute amorphous-core OPT impedance-converter stage for milliwatts output, sufficient for the TP1. Preamplifier (or None if Integrated): None. Speakers: Single Lowther TP-1 Corner Reproducer. Very high efficiency (approaching 50% so 40 milliwatts input is loud enough for me!)
Sources: CD Player/DAC: None. Turntable/Phono Stage: Garrard 401/SME 3012 S1/Ortofon S-15M/T or Ortofon SPU-G/T plus Tannoy Variluctance:1 mil for '50s vinyl,3 mil for shellacs.
The Ortofon transformer secondaries are connected in series for potent mono output.Other Source(s): Stellavox SP-7 tape recorder with ABR big-reel adaptor and 19cm/s & 38cm/s IEC head blocks. 1957 Bush VHF64 radio in another room and Mono Quad (II + ELS) with Lenco L70 upstairs. Other Accessories/Room/Misc.: Speaker Cables/Interconnects: Single Cat 5 twisted pair for the Lowther.
Gotham GAC-1 for interconnects.Other (Power Conditioner, Racks etc.): IKEA Froejstra solid birch supporting tables on oak flooring over concrete. Tweaks: I'm not the tweaky sort
